Hi Reinhard, Reinhard Karcher - 26.02.21, 13:31:09 CET: > Am Freitag, 26. Februar 2021, 13:11 schrieb Norbert Preining: […] > > > Any aptitude / apt foo magic recommendation? Otherwise I try to > > > come up with something myself. > > > > Many options, I usually do > > > > aptitude -t experimental > > > > and then select all the plasma etc related packages, that normally > > works nicely. > > I use the command: > aptitude install '~i ~V5\.21\.1' -t experimental > for Version 5.21.1. > apt should work with the same options, but I didn't test it.
Thanks, Luc, Norbert and Reinhard! I went with this one. It worked out of the box. So far 5.21.1 appears to be working just fine. I wondered about having to specify from which version to which version to upgrade, but I see now, if the version number is unique enough I can get away with just specifying the target version.
